Janssen Research & Development sponsors 593 registered US clinical trials on ClinicalTrials.gov, 68 of them currently recruiting, and 384 completed. 179 of these trials are in Phase 3-4 (later-stage) and 377 in Phase 1-2 (earlier-stage). The most-studied condition in this pipeline is Healthy, with 25 trials.

Trial completion reliability score

D 60/100

384 of 436 decided trials (Completed vs. Terminated on ClinicalTrials.gov) reached their planned completion (88.1%), vs. national p10 68.4% / p90 100% among 1,234 sponsors with at least 10 decided trials. Still-open trials (Recruiting, Active-not-recruiting, Not-yet-recruiting) are excluded since they have not reached an outcome yet.

How open-pipeline share is computed

Recruiting share is recruiting_count divided by trial_count for this sponsor in the public registry export. Status can change between pulls; treat the figure as a research-attention snapshot, not product availability.
